Power Systems — General and Administrative Expense

Cummins Power Systems — General and Administrative Expense decreased by 5.7% to $99.00M in Q4 2025 compared to the prior quarter. Year-over-year, this metric declined by 6.6%, from $106.00M to $99.00M. Over 3 years (FY 2022 to FY 2025), Power Systems — General and Administrative Expense shows an upward trend with a 15.1% CAGR. This is a positive signal — lower values indicate better performance for this metric.
